One of Europe’s Most Wanted arrested and returned to Sweden from Cancun

Cancun, Q.R. — A criminal leader listed as a most wanted in Europe was tracked down living in Cancun. A second person, a man considered his main logistical and financial operator, was also arrested.

Authorities reported on the weekend arrest of Mikael “N”, a Swedish criminal leader wanted across Europe for arms trafficking, drug trafficking and money laundering. Police say he is considered a generator of violence in Europe.

Authorities also reported on the arrest of a second man, Tomás Alejandro “N”, “a subject considered his main logistical and financial operator.”

Mexico City authorities reported that following a request for cooperation from the Swedish Police, a search was launched for Mikael “N”. He is wanted by Europol with an outstanding arrest warrant and had a red notice with Interpol for his involvement in arms trafficking, drug trafficking and money laundering.

“With this information, contact was established with international security agencies to exchange information and identify his potential areas of activity,” government authorities reported Saturday.

Fixed and mobile surveillance was implemented at various locations in Yucatan and Quintana Roo where ground patrols were conducted and technological tools were used to locate the addresses where he was staying.

Based on intelligence, the target’s presence was confirmed in Cancun where he was found driving with one of his main financial agents. Police said a security operation was implemented on the Cancun-Merida highway from where they were stopped and detained.

“During the inspection, various doses of drugs were seized,” they reported.

Mikael Michalis “N”, alias “El Griego”, was taken to the appropriate immigration station for transfer to Europe under custody and later handed over to the Swedish police.

The other individual in his company, Tomás Alejandro “N”, was placed at the disposal of the corresponding Public Prosecutor’s Office who will determine his legal status and continue with the corresponding proceedings.

On Saturday, Omar H Garcia Harfuch, Secretary of Security and Citizen Protection of Mexico said “as a result of an investigation by the National Intelligence Center, officers arrested Mikael Michalis “N,” alias “El Griego,” in Quintana Roo. He is wanted for arms trafficking, drug trafficking, and money laundering.

Mikael Michalis “N”, alias “El Griego”

He has a red card and an arrest warrant in Sweden, identified as the leader of the “Dalen” criminal group. Also arrested was Tomás Alejandro “N,” who is being investigated for operations involving illicit proceeds.”

The Security Cabinet institutions reaffirm their commitment to working in coordination with international security agencies to stop the perpetrators of violence that affect society.

“As part of the inter-institutional collaboration with international security agencies, in Quintana Roo, elements of the Secretariat of Security and Citizen Protection (SSPC), Secretariat of National Defense (Defense), Secretariat of the Navy (Semar), Attorney General of the Republic (FGR) and National Guard (GN), together with the Secretariat of Citizen Security (SSC) of Quintana Roo, the National Migration Institute (INM) and Interpol,” participated authorities reported.
